Rose “Dolly” Moore died on the morning of January 24, 2021 with her daughter at her side. She had a long life filled with many happy moments, and was welcomed into heaven by deceased family and friends.
She married Luther “Jack” Moore on May 14, 1949, and they resided in Chicago before moving to Roselle in 1959. There they raised their four children, then moved to Green Valley, AZ in September, 2004. Rose moved back to Roselle in February, 2012, and was a resident of Sunrise of Bloomingdale from March, 2016 until present.
Rose was known for her sense of humor and easily made friends wherever she was. Her children and grandchildren have many fond memories of her funny comments and easy going demeanor. She was a gentle soul and always had a mischievous gleam in her eyes. She will be terribly missed by us all.
